Format of Competition
Competition will consist of two rounds.
Round1
Each participating Team will be required to submit a soft copy of an Executive Summary in a PDF format not exceeding three pages (2000 words). The summary should be specific and should cover the following points:
1.Pain points that your product / solution addresses
2.Team- responsibilities shared by each member of team and how the person is best suited for role.
3.Uniqueness of the product or service or technology
4.Scope of revenue generation from this business opportunity.
5.Market Opportunity
6.Competition
7.Financials (Initial Investment & Working Capital)
8.Strategy of Execution
Round 2 (Business Plan Presentation)
Top Ten short listed teams of Round 1 will move to Round 2. Each team is required online presentation of 5 minutes duration followed by Q&A of 3 to 5 minutes. Esteemed external panel will vet the presented plans.
The winners will be decided by presenting of information as listed in Round 1 with following additional elaboration of:
1. Business Potential of The Idea
a. Market interest from potential partners or clients demonstrated.
b. Market size and potential growth realistically appraised.
2. Customer’s Buying Decision
a. Customer Key Performance Indicators (KPI) discussed.
3. Competition
a. Competitors and competing technologies identified and defined.
b. Strengths of the technology against competitors compelling.
4. Commercialization Strategy
a. Business model and “go to market” strategy options clearly outlined.
5. Avenues for Financial Resources
